The Integration of Technology

Gone are the days when professional sport leagues relied solely on human referees and judges. With the rapid advancement of technology, leagues have embraced the use of cutting-edge gadgets and software to enhance the viewer experience and ensure fair play.

From goal-line technology in football to Hawk-Eye systems in tennis, these leagues have left no stone unturned in their quest for precision. But it doesn’t stop there! We now have drones capturing breathtaking aerial shots, virtual reality experiences that make us feel like we’re right there on the field, and even robot umpires in baseball. Who would have thought that one day we’d be debating calls made by a machine?
